The Role:
As Associate Ecologist, you’ll play a key role in expanding the ecology offering across Yorkshire and the North. You'll lead complex and meaningful projects, mentor junior consultants, and collaborate with other technical disciplines to deliver integrated environmental solutions.
You’ll be based out of a brand-new Leeds office and will work closely with senior leadership to develop client relationships, grow the ecology pipeline, and make a real impact in the region.
Responsibilities:
- Plan and deliver a wide range of ecological surveys (including UKHabs and protected species)
- Produce and review high-quality reports: PEAs, EIAs, BNGs, HRAs, Mitigation Strategies
- Lead and manage complex ecological projects from start to finish
- Support and mentor junior consultants and graduates
- Engage in business development and attend industry events
- Collaborate across landscape, planning, and arboriculture teams
- Build and maintain strong client relationships
What We’re Looking For:
- Degree in Ecology or Biological Sciences
- CIEEM membership (working towards Chartership)
- Strong field survey skills; UKHabs and at least one protected species licence
- Experience in project and budget management
- Excellent communication and leadership skills
- Strong knowledge of UK wildlife legislation and planning frameworks
- Full UK Driving Licence
